Output 250158676603ab7dfa92efdeb8c31f5fb40304cd63ce0b6289bcfa58a87825ca:7

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 ebd6102072f14ec10285f18a6e31a45d6650035b
address
tb1qa0tpqgrj798vzq597x9xuvdyt4n9qq6ml3ry4k
transaction
250158676603ab7dfa92efdeb8c31f5fb40304cd63ce0b6289bcfa58a87825ca